How they compare
Finland currently reports 681,839 1000 SLC against 552,615 1000 SLC in Croatia, a difference of 129,224 1000 SLC.
That makes Finland's figure about 1.2 times Croatia's.
The two have swapped places 6 times across 33 shared years of data; in 1992 it was Finland ahead.
Croatia ranks 111th and Finland ranks 108th of 152 countries.
Finland has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Croatia | Finland |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 362,806 1000 SLC | 580,273 1000 SLC | 217,467 1000 SLC | Finland |
| 2000s | 328,963 1000 SLC | 464,895 1000 SLC | 135,932 1000 SLC | Finland |
| 2010s | 432,230 1000 SLC | 567,811 1000 SLC | 135,581 1000 SLC | Finland |
| 2020s | 632,559 1000 SLC | 706,573 1000 SLC | 74,015 1000 SLC | Finland |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The domain provides detailed data on the value of agricultural production that is calculated by the agricultural production data and the price data at farm gate. Thus, the value of production measures the agricultural production in monetary terms at the farm gate level.
